I am very disappointed to learn that the Tab S7 (wifi), one of Samsungs' latest Tablets, does not support Samsung Health and so is no good for supporting their Active wearables.

If you have a Garmin watch then Garmin Connect is compatible with the Tab S7. If you have a Fitbit then the Fitbit app is compatible. In fact the apps for all the major competitors are compatible. Samsung, however, do not support their own app or hardware.

You wouldn't believe it would you!

Samsung Health is incompatible with the Tab S7 (wifi). Samsung have confirmed this to me!

..Hi Nick  

So pleased to read the APK Mirror Samsung Health APK Download worked fine for you too!

No idea why Samsung don't make it officially available..a complete mystery as they allow Google Fit etc..!

As a side note, I have a new Galaxy Watch 4 Classic and in Thailand, the FDA haven't approved Samsung Health Monitor and Blood Pressure and ECG monitoring..not Samsung's fault of course..

With some online research, I discovered a clever member on XDA Developers had developed a work around, which involves USB Debugging, and a few other setting changes on the Watch in Developer mode. Then you can download some new APKs onto the Watch and Phone and magically SHM, Blood Pressure and ECG monitoring now all work on my Watch and Phone app!
